Ralph R. King was born in 1925 in Pennsylvania, the child of Richard Livingston King And Gladys Macdonald. In 1930, Ralph R. King resided in Clarks Summit, Lackawanna, Pennsylvania. In 1935, Ralph R. King resided in Nicholson, PA. Ralph R. King passed away in 1997 in Nicholson, Wyoming, Pennsylvania.
